Context: The Hype Machine

NAVI Protocol is a DeFi lending protocol on Sui, a Layer 1 that touts parallel execution and Move language safety. NAVI Prime is positioned as a layered lending product—think Aave v3’s eMode or Compound III’s isolation markets, but with a “customized risk framework” tailored to different borrower profiles. The narrative is seductive: permissioned lending for institutions, optimized collateral ratios, enhanced capital efficiency.

But the article that announced this product is a ghost. It lacks the one thing any serious auditor needs: raw data. No specific LTV thresholds, no liquidation curves, no oracle integrations. The only concrete fact is the deployment on Sui. The rest is a wishlist.

Core: The Autopsy

Let me dissect what we actually know, and more importantly, what we don’t.

Technical Foundation: A Repackaged eMode?

The “customized risk framework” is not a paradigm shift. Aave v3 already allows asset-specific risk parameters via eMode and isolation mode. NAVI Prime is a parameterization exercise—moving sliders on LTV, liquidation thresholds, and interest rate curves. The innovation? It’s on Sui. That gives it Move’s resource model, which inherently prevents reentrancy and double-spend attacks. That is a genuine advantage. But the framework itself is incremental.

The article does not mention any independent audit. In my years auditing DeFi protocols—from the Compound governance exploit to the Terra-Luna collapse—I have learned that custom risk parameters introduce a new attack surface. If the risk manager role is a single multisig or a governance token with low participation, the system becomes a target.

Tokenomics: The Black Hole

Zero information. No supply schedule, no emission curve, no revenue split. The NAVI token is presumably governance and utility, but without data, any valuation is a guess. The article claims NAVI Prime “may improve capital efficiency.” That is not analysis; that is a prayer.

From my experience reverse-engineering the Terra-Luna mechanism, I know that when a protocol hides its tokenomics, it is usually because the numbers are ugly. DeFi lending protocols often rely on liquidity mining to inflate TVL. The real question: what percentage of NAVI’s APR comes from genuine lending fees vs. token subsidies? Without on-chain data, this is unknowable.

Market Position: The Sui Bubble

Sui’s ecosystem is growing, but it is still a fraction of Ethereum’s. NAVI faces direct competition from Scallop, Suilend, and Bucket Protocol. The “customized risk framework” gives NAVI a differentiation play—targeting institutional borrowers. But the differentiation window is days, not months. Scallop can copy the feature set in a week.

The article’s bullish claim is that NAVI Prime will “reshape DeFi lending dynamics.” That is a narrative, not a fact. The real metric is TVL growth and borrowing utilization. The article provides none.

Contrarian: What the Bulls Got Right

Let me be fair. The bulls have a point: Sui is a legitimate Layer 1 with strong technical foundations. The Move language reduces a class of smart contract bugs. NAVI’s existing TVL suggests some organic adoption. If NAVI Prime successfully attracts institutional liquidity—say, from market makers or RWA platforms—it could generate real fee revenue.

But “could” is not a thesis. The absence of disclosed audit or team credentials is a signal. A protocol that is confident in its security publishes the audit report. A protocol that is confident in its tokenomics publishes the supply schedule. NAVI did neither.

Takeaway: The Accountability Call

The article is a product announcement disguised as a news event. It offers no new information that a DeFiLlama dashboard cannot show. Investors should treat NAVI Prime as a marketing stunt until the following are public:

  • A complete audit report from a reputable firm (e.g., Trail of Bits, OpenZeppelin).
  • On-chain data showing NAVI Prime’s TVL, borrowing volume, and liquidation history.
  • Tokenomics with lockup schedules and distribution breakdown.
